Coming soon: YouTube’s Veo 2 

YouTube Shorts just leveled up. With the introduction of Veo 2, Google DeepMind’s latest video wizardry, creators can now conjure up entire video clips with just a few words.

Gone are the days of tweaking just your backgrounds. While Dream Screen gave us AI-generated backdrops, Veo 2 takes things to a whole different level. Think dreamy slow-motion butterflies in a sunlit forest or a gritty urban timelapse with a specific cinematic flair. Just type it out, and Veo 2 brings it to life.

What makes this upgrade exciting? Real-world physics and human movement. According to YouTube’s Product Director, Dina Berrada, you can now fine-tune styles, lenses, and cinematic effects—making creativity as effortless as sending a text.

Starting Thursday, creators in the US, Canada, Australia, and New Zealand can explore this AI-powered playground. Simply open the Shorts camera, tap Green Screen, find Dream Screen, and let your imagination run wild. Of course, with great power comes great responsibility. Each Veo 2 creation will carry DeepMind’s SynthID watermark, ensuring transparency about its AI origins. 

In the ongoing AI arms race (looking at you, OpenAI’s Sora), Veo 2 is YouTube’s bold statement: the future of video creation is already here.
